Abstract

The favourable combination of mechanical properties and corrosion resistance in Duplex Stainless Steels (DSS) is due to their biphasic microstructure, consisting of almost equal volume fractions of ferrite and austenite. However, all types of DSS are subject to secondary phases precipitation phenomena, especially in the temperature range 600–1000°C, which can occur even for very short soaking times, compromising the interesting properties of these steels.

The main secondary phase observed in DSS is the intermetallic σ-phase, which forms from ferrite via eutectoidic decomposition at high temperatures, and is generally accompanied by the formation of another intermetallic, the χ-phase. The precipitation of these phases is mainly observed in the high-alloyed DSS grades, while in the lower-alloyed Lean DSS it has not been reported, probably owing to reduced levels of chromium and molybdenum. On the contrary, in all DSS grades nitrides precipitation is usually observed.

In this work, the precipitation kinetics of secondary phases in two Lean DSS are examined, after isothermally treating the materials within the critical temperature ranges. In grade LDX 2101, only nitrides were detected, whereas a significant precipitation of σ-phase was ob-served in LDX 2404 for soaking times longer than 1 hour.
